TEHRAN: Iranian short film 'Make My Bed in the Room', found its way to the competition section of the 17th Short Shorts Film Festival and Asia in Tokyo this year.
The Short Shorts Film Festival and Asia, a qualifying film festival for the annual Academy Awards and one of Asia’s largest international short film festivals, will be held in Tokyo and Yokohama from June 2-26, Iran Daily reported on Sunday.
The festival is a comprehensive short film brand that leads the creation of film culture through avenues such as its film festival (Short Shorts Film Festival and Asia), its short film specialist cinema (Brillia Short Shorts Theater) and its Contents business.
The short film, directed by Amir Toudeh-Rousta, depicts the life of a family grieving for the loss of their son.
